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Ballard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Ballard with 1 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Ballard is at TWG South listed at $1,375.

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Ballard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Ballard is $2,381.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Ballard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Ballard is a 1,011 square feet unit starting from $3,427 at Henry.

What is the average size for Ballard 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Ballard is currently 666 sq ft.
